Check Digit Verification of cas no

The CAS Registry Mumber 1187980-73-9 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,1,8,7,9,8 and 0 respectively; the second part has 2 digits, 7 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 1187980-73:
(9*1)+(8*1)+(7*8)+(6*7)+(5*9)+(4*8)+(3*0)+(2*7)+(1*3)=209
209 % 10 = 9
So 1187980-73-9 is a valid CAS Registry Number.

Iodine monobromide catalysed regioselective synthesis of 3-arylquinolines from α-aminoacetophenones and: Trans -β-nitrostyrenes

Gattu, Radhakrishna,Mondal, Santa,Ali, Saghir,Khan, Abu T.

, p. 347 - 353 (2019/01/10)

A simple and efficient method for regioselective synthesis of 3-arylquinolines is described from α-aminoacetophenones and trans-β-nitrostyrenes using 20 mol% iodine monobromide as a catalyst in acetonitrile solvent at 80 °C. The present method involves tandem reaction of α-aminoacetophenones and trans-β-nitrostyrenes, formation of two new C-C bonds and cleavage of one C-C bond in a single step. The salient features of the protocol are metal- and oxidant-free reaction conditions, broad substrate scope, and good yields.
